break up 核心詞議:
phr. 結束;(使)破碎;放假;(使)散開
break up基本解釋
結束;(使)破碎;放假;(使)散開

- Police have been deployed to break up several parent protests since the earthquake .
- 自從地震發生以來,警方已幾次趕來驅散示威家長。
- Officials ordered the police to break up the rally resulting in clashes injuries and arrests .
- 政府命令出警驅散集會的群眾,最終導致沖突,多人受傷并受到拘捕。
- Her coalition would probably break up .
- 她的聯盟很可能會分裂。
- This rough uneven surface could serve to break up and attenuate waves weakening surges .
- 粗糙不平的表面可以用來打斷、減弱海浪,削弱巨浪的威力。
- Are you destined to break up ?
- 難道你們注定要分手嗎?
- Nor is anyone talking seriously about using antitrust laws to break up the biggest banks the traditional tonic for any capitalist entity that is too big to fail .
- 也沒有任何人認真討論一下如何利用反壟斷法來拆散最大的幾家銀行反壟斷法是針對一切“規模過大不能倒閉”的資本主義實體的傳統藥方。
- Holding euro-denominated assets also incurs the long-term risk that the single currency may one day break up .
- 持有歐元計價資產還會帶來長期風險,因為歐元也許某一天就會崩潰。
- Why did we break up ?
- 我們為什么分手的來著?
- As the glaciers break up into smaller pieces more of the darker surface of the crater is exposed .
- 隨著冰川破裂而變成越來越小的冰塊,更多隕石坑較暗的表層顯露出來。
- The bank will probably break up the block of shares and resell them .
- 該行很可能將這部分股權打散再出售。
